The Intercultural Confluences Research Centre of the Department of Humanities, Faculty of Economics, Socio-Human Sciences and Engineering, Miercurea Ciuc, Sapientia Hungarian University of Transylvania, Romania, in cooperation with the Regional Committee in Cluj of the Hungarian Academy of Sciences, organizes the International Conference  Közvetítés / Transmitere / Transmission in Miercurea Ciuc, Piața Libertății 1, on 21-22 March, 2025. The working languages of the conference are Hungarian, Romanian, and English. Submission deadline: 31 January 2025.

The theory and practice of transmission, the conveyance of meaning in various forms and media, interpretation, and the interaction between socio-cultural contexts are increasingly becoming central issues in the humanities. The aim of the conference is to explore, in an interdisciplinary approach, how transmission works in diverse scientific and artistic fields, and how messages, meanings, and interpretations are shaped in language, culture, society, media and the arts.

There is order in the world if we create it by thinking rationally. It is worth thinking in a way that we are constantly in dialogue with each other, we turn to the eternal Other. We attempt to convey what matters to us, while also listening to the Other’s perspective and reflecting on which of his/her values might benefit us. The mediator of Order, of the will of gods, is Hermes, who creates a connection between the two spheres. He is also the patron of literature, and of other representatives of exchanges, merchants and thieves. The hermeneutics of understanding also presupposes a dialogue: through the Gadamerian fusion of horizons, it is achieved by the creation of a shared space between the two separate entities. Albert-László Barabási highlights the importance of multidirectional communication, the role of networks in the act of transmission.

From a linguistic perspective, transmission offers a variety of research opportunities. In the course of transmission, several aspects of language use emerge. Translation is not only linguistic but also cultural transmission. Furthermore, pragmatic factors in communication, such as the speech situation, alignment with the Other, the choice of linguistic forms, the use of non-verbal cues and rhetorical techniques, all influence the process and effectiveness of transmission. In today’s digital age, the emergence of diverse technological tools poses new challenges to the process of mediation.

We welcome presentations in the following domains:

  • Literary studies (literary theory, literary criticism, literature and other arts);
  • Linguistics (applied linguistics, sociolinguistics, psycholinguistics, history of language, comparative linguistics);
  • Film and visual studies;
  • Cultural studies;
  • Language teaching;
  • Translation Studies.

Proposed topics of the conference:

  • forms and possibilities of understanding;
  • creation of meaning, representation of meaning, metaphorical transmission;
  • ways of transmitting identity and alterity;
  • cultural, ethnic, and linguistic mediation;
  • cultural transfer, cultural mobility;
  • transnational mediation;
  • cultural transmission in the digital age;
  • crossovers between genres;
  • intermediality, transmediality;
  • multimodality, adaptation;
  • the transmission of myths in literature and the sister arts;
  • bilingualism and multilingualism as forms of language transmission;
  • translanguaging, code-switching;
  • language connections, language variants, and their mediators;
  • translation as mediation between languages and cultures;
  • transmission and internationalization;
  • transmission of knowledge.

Each lecture will be allotted 20 minutes for the presentation, followed by discussions. The conference will also include online panels. The keynote lectures and the online participants’ own panels will be transmitted online.

Plenary speakers

  • Dr. habil. KATALIN DORÓ,Associate Professor, University of Szeged
  • Dr. GEORGIANA LUNGU-BADEA, Professor, West University of Timișoara
  • Dr. habil. JOLÁN ORBÁN, Professor, University of Pécs

 

Submission guidelines

  • In order to participate, please fill in the ONLINE REGISTRATION FORM.
  • You can apply individually or in panels of 3-4 presenters.
  • Please submit an abstract of maximum 250 words, written Hungarian/Romanian and English. The abstract submission deadline is January 31, 2025. Notification of acceptance will be sent by February 10, 2025.
  • We are expecting original and unpublished articles related to the topic of transmission. A selection of papers, based on favourable peer-review, will be published in the 2025 volume of Acta Universitatis Sapientiae, Philologica, the international scientific journal of the Sapientia Hungarian University of Transylvania, indexed in several scientific databases, as well as the conference volume edited by the Scientia Publishing House, a recognized academic publisher.
